What Your Bakery Website in Fort Wayne Must Include

A high-performing Fort Wayne bakery website must prioritize local search intent, which for bakeries is predominantly planned and research-phase. This means implementing specific schema markup for 'Bakery' and 'Product' types, detailing items like 'wedding cakes Fort Wayne' or 'gluten-free pastries Fort Wayne', along with pricing and availability. Integrating a clear online ordering system, especially for custom orders, is paramount, as customers are not seeking emergency services but rather specific products. Trust signals are crucial; while the Indiana Professional Licensing Agency doesn't regulate bakeries directly, displaying health inspection scores, certifications from local food safety programs, and testimonials from Fort Wayne residents builds confidence. Your site needs to clearly present your menu, operating hours, and location, particularly for neighborhoods like '07' or 'Historic Southwood Park', ensuring that a potential customer can quickly find what they need and place an order without friction. A mobile-first design is non-negotiable, as many Fort Wayne residents will be searching for their next sweet treat on the go.

Common Website Mistakes Fort Wayne Bakeries Make

Many Fort Wayne bakeries, particularly those established before 2010, make critical website mistakes that hinder their online visibility and conversion rates. First, neglecting mobile optimization is rampant; slow-loading sites or non-responsive designs alienate the majority of Fort Wayne users searching on their phones for 'cupcakes Fort Wayne'. Second, a lack of specific product schema markup means search engines struggle to understand what your bakery offers, making it nearly impossible to rank for niche searches like 'vegan bakery Fort Wayne'. Third, many sites fail to integrate a clear call-to-action for online ordering or custom quote requests, forcing potential customers to call or visit, which is a barrier for the research-phase intent. Finally, outdated or missing business information, such as incorrect hours or addresses, creates distrust and leads to lost business. Rectifying these issues is not merely about aesthetics; it's about capturing the significant planned purchase intent prevalent in the Fort Wayne bakery market.

Do Bakeries in Fort Wayne need a website or can they use a directory listing?

Bakeries in Fort Wayne absolutely need a dedicated website, not just directory listings. While platforms like Yelp or Facebook can provide some visibility, they offer limited control over branding, customer experience, and direct online ordering. A proprietary website allows for detailed menu presentation, custom order forms, and direct communication, which are crucial for the planned purchase intent of bakery customers. Relying solely on third-party directories means you're always competing on their terms, and you lose valuable customer data and direct conversion opportunities specific to Fort Wayne's market.
